This postseason series will feel very different than the regular season vs the Braves.

First off, the teams aren't playing in either Atlanta or Miami, so playing in Houston will completely even out the games as far as any "home field advantage" is concerned for either team.

Second, the Marlins will have Sandy, Sixto and Pablo ready to go 1,2,3.. So it's not like the Braves are coming into a series vs. Yamamoto, Urena, Rogers/Castano (Although Rogers and Castano did have some very solid outings this season!)

Finally, of course some different fans, sports writers and broadcasters will bring up the 29-9 loss every chance they get. That's ok, at the end of the day, in the NLDS the Marlins can lose 2 games 24-1 and 12-0, but if they win the other 3 games, they're winning the series and continuing on, and in the playoffs that's all that counts.
